How much do customer operations associ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 1, 2026, the average hourly pay for customer operations associate in Norwalk, IA is $24.07,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.77 and $25.67 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a customer operations associate?

To thrive as a Customer Operations Associate, you need strong probl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and familiarity with customer service processes, often supported by a bachelor’s degree or relevant experience. Proficiency with customer relationship management (CRM) software, ticketing systems, and basic office tools like spreadsheets is typically required. Excellent communication, patience, and a proactive attitude are essential soft skills for effectively addressing customer needs and collaborating with internal teams. These skills and qualities are crucial for ensuring customer satisfaction, efficient operations, and high-quality service delivery.

What are some common challenges faced by customer operations associates, and how can they be managed?

Customer Operations Associates often encounter challenges such as managing high volumes of customer inquiries, addressing complex or sensitive issues, and adapting to frequently changing procedures or technologies. Staying organized, maintaining clear communication, and proactively collaborating with team members can help manage these challenges effectively. Many organizations also provide ongoing training and support, enabling associates to continually develop their problem-solving and customer service skills.

What is the difference between Customer Operations Associate vs Customer Service Representative?

AspectCustomer Operations AssociateCustomer Service Representative
Primary FocusHandling operational processes, order management, and backend supportAssisting customers directly with inquiries, complaints, and product information
Required SkillsProcess management, technical proficiency, problem-solvingCommunication skills, empathy, product knowledge
Work EnvironmentBackend teams, cross-departmental collaborationFrontline customer interaction, call centers, retail
Common UsageIn logistics, e-commerce, SaaS companiesIn retail, telecom, service industries

The Customer Operations Associate primarily manages backend processes and operational tasks, while the Customer Service Representative focuses on direct customer interactions. Both roles are essential in customer support but differ in their scope and daily responsibilities.

Corporate Security Operations Associate

Wellmark, Inc.

Des Moines, IA

Full-time

Posted 8 days ago


Job description

Company Description

Why Wellmark: We are a mutual insurance company owned by our policy holders across Iowa and South Dakota, and we've built our reputation on over 80 years' worth of trust. We are not motivated by profits. We are motivated by the well-being of our friends, family, and neighbors-our members. If you're passionate about joining an organization working hard to put its members first, to provide best-in-class service, and one that is committed to sustainability and innovation, consider applying today! 

Learn more about our unique benefit offerings here. 

Job Description

Are you someone who constantly notices the details, prioritizes safety and is often known for your friendly presence around others? If you're calm under pressure, enjoy helping people, and like workdays that keep you engaged and moving, this could be a great fit. In this role, you'll be the friendly face greeting guests, the extra set of eyes helping keep our campus secure, and a trusted resource supporting everything from access control to emergency response. We're looking for someone who combines professionalism, strong communication skills, and a customer-first mindset. Bring your attention to detail and problem-solving abilities, and we'll provide opportunities to grow your skills in a dynamic security environment.

Qualifications

Required:

High school diploma or GED is required.

1+ year experience in security, law enforcement or military; including familiarity with security systems/equipment.

Must have or be able to attain additional skills and training regarding systems and procedures used in a physical security setting.

Effective written and verbal communication skills. Previous experience communicating between internal and external stakeholders.

Excellent attention to detail, multi-tasking, and organizational skills, including time management and prioritization.

Ability to remain professional, calm, and focused, adaptable and flexible, in a fast-paced, changing environment.

Demonstrated ability to work collaboratively with a team, partner with others throughout the organization, and provide advisement

and coaching on security-related issues.

Ability to troubleshoot effectively and proactively seek opportunities for process improvement.

Microsoft Office experience - e.g., Word, Excel, Outlook, etc. Technical aptitude to learn new systems quickly.

Ability to work full time on-site daily at assigned location.

Additional Information

a. Operate and control the telecommunications, alarm monitoring, camera systems, access control, and life safety systems for Wellmark properties.

b. Act as the intermediary between emergency situations and emergency response personnel; convey information to the emergency personnel and ensuring appropriate response to observed conditions.

c. Greet and provide exceptional customer service to all Wellmark guests and workforce.

d. Monitor and provide oversight of surveillance of the premises and patrol assigned areas to ensure the safety and protection of guests, team members and company assets.

e. Support visitor management processes, including access requests and badge administration.

f. Secure premises and personnel and prevent losses and damage by reporting irregularities.

g. Support site management of Wellmark parking which may include verifications of entrance into garage, patrol of garage, security camera monitoring of garage, etc.

h. Administer and maintain corporate parking programs, including processing parking registrations, issuing permits, maintaining parking records, and responding to employee parking inquiries.

i. Assist with general administrative tasks related to physical security operations, facilities coordination, and employee safety programs.

j. May provide support in other areas such as Facilities and special event activities, etc., and business-related initiatives as needed.

k. Other duties as assigned.
